The hexadecimal color code #76937A corresponds to the code RGB( 118, 147, 122 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,46 level), green (at 0,58 level) and blue (at 0,48 level). Its brightness is 51% and its saturation is 11%. It is composed of red at 30%, green at 37% and blue at 31%.
